'Don't play the moral card, Joel!': Big Brother's Jack loses his cool when Joel gives up an endurance task to scoff pizza
Joel angered his housemates when he was duped into spending £2,500 of the winner’s prize money on a small frozen pizza over the weekend.
And the Welsh lad once again came face-to-face with his self-confessed ‘Achilles heel’ on Wednesday night’s episode of Big Brother, giving up on a group task to gorge on takeaway pizza.
While the rest of the gang weren't bothered by his decision, Jack – who spent much of Day 57 moaning that he hadn't eaten properly in over a week – was furious at his pal for throwing in the towel, leading to a tense exchange between them.

The drama occurred during an endurance task to win back some prize fund money, involving the housemates each holding up a bag of money for as long as possible.
Chloe was in charge of secretly allocating a cash sum to each person according to how well she thought they would perform, correctly pegging competitive Christian and Danny as the top earners.
Naturally, Big Brother threw in a few obstacles along the way to tempt them to give up, including a pretty ice-cream vendor, a phone call from Jack’s dad – which he refused to answer – and a pile of piping hot pizzas.

Joel could barely contain his excitement at the sight of his favourite food, visibly drooling as he watched the housemates who had already failed the task tucking into the sizzling slices.
He opted to give up so he could indulge in the takeaway, declaring, ‘Everyone who knows me will understand.’
The down-to-earth contestant later explained in the Diary Room, ‘I gave in after three hours and 40 minutes and ate the pizza. I was hoping people would forget about my ordeal with pizza on the weekend, but now they won't. Pizza is my Achilles heel. I respect Danny, Jack and Sam for staying out there.’

The final straw came when Big Brother announced there would be an auction for the housemates to win back their confiscated suitcases.
After four days of wearing the same smelly clothes, everyone but Danny and Christian – who were still going strong 12 hours into the task – opted to take part in the secret bid, declaring how much money they’d be willing to sacrifice from the winner's fund in order to get their possessions back.
Only Sam and Jack actually bid, however, each saying they’d forsake £100, and both visibly squirmed under the gaze of their self-sacrificing housemates.

Team player Chloe diplomatically told them: ‘Those two guys are standing out there all day. I think the nicest idea would be to stick together and not waste any money from what they’re trying to win. They’ve not had the opportunity to get their suitcases back.’
‘You only ever wear your dressing gown anyway!’, she rightly told Jack.
But when Joel chimed in, saying, ‘Those two are out there, earning money for everyone!’, Jack lost his cool. He fired back, ‘Don’t play the moral card Joel, you gave up to eat pizza.’

The frosty atmosphere remained as the task came to an end and Chloe’s secret mission was revealed.
Christian, Danny and Sam’s perseverance meant they’d collectively added 21k to the prize money, and spirits were high as the group celebrated.
However, poor Jack was once again left red-faced as it emerged his so-called best friend Chloe had tipped him to be the first to give up, allocating him a bag worth £0.
‘I’m so surprised at Jack, he’s done amazing’, she said of his valiant effort in the Diary Room.
